
BYDL - Untitled VI And V [Self release - 2023]BYDL is a Vienna-based noise project- which has seemingly been active since the turn of the 2020’s. Untitled VI And V is it’s first venture into wall noise- with the two tracks here we have a very primal/ organic nature-based ANW- which rather brought to mind a less simplistic take on the type of thing Lungwash dis in the early to mid-2010s. The release is a self-release- which is now just digital- though the project sold a single copy of the release on a recycled cassette. The digital cover is a hazed grey, white and black affair- showing something grainy half-light- possibly a bent and pale human back. So this adds a rewarding sense of eerie mystery to the release.
So first out of gates is “Untitled VI”- this runs at thirty-one minutes & fifty-three seconds. The ‘wall’ features a muffled ‘n’ murky rattling judder- which rather sounded like some form of underwater rushing recordings. Around this, we find this a loser & smaller static grain jittering- which at points sound like they are becoming more manic/ rapid- but I think, this to be a trick of the ‘wall’.
The other track here is "Untitled V". It comes in at the twenty-seven minutes & forty-nine-second mark. The track brings together a deep subterranean bass roll ‘n’ billow, with a tight jittering static grain- and way off in the distance I can just make out a looped wavering ‘n’ lonesome high-pitch tone glow. This track keeps feeling like it might suddenly stop or fade back more- but this never occurs, and we get a great general feeling of natural based dread & unease.
